Chicago has always been a "what have you done for me lately" type of family. It's been strongly hinted that Lombardo was on the shelf when he was indicted and Marcello's powerbase had severely eroded by the time of his conviction. Sarno (and by extension, a lot of his guys) was probably happy to see him go away, especially after he (allegedly) had Marcello's top guy disappeared. All that said, it does appear that Frank Jr. isn't just someone who can walk into any place in the city and be treated like one of the guys, either.
